Disclosure requirements mean the cost of borrowing must be stated before an agreement is signed.
A credit file is compiled by private agencies from information lenders and other creditors report. A lender may ask for proof of address, and a permanent address is a standard requirement for consumer credit.
The British Columbia rules that apply
Consumer lending in British Columbia is licensed provincially or territorially, and the Financial Consumer Agency of Canada publishes the list of provincial and territorial regulators where the current position appears.
The federal Payday Lending Regulations (SOR/2024-114) list British Columbia among the provinces that regulate payday lending, where the federal Payday Lending Regulations (SOR/2024-114) cap the cost of borrowing at $14 per $100 advanced.

The census figures for Cowichan Valley A
Cowichan Valley A recorded a population of 4,949 in Statistics Canada's 2021 Census of Population. The community covers 49.2 square kilometres of land.
On those two figures, density is 100.6 residents per square kilometre when rounded to one decimal place.
